One thing I've always wondered .......
You take a pitch with a motorhome (at a club site) which is generally charged at the same rate as a caravan.
What happens when you take a car along with a motorhome (whether towed or driven).
Do they charge extra for it?
Site policy is normally to charge for an extra car, but then a caravan set up includes the van and a car.

Never took a car along with my motorhome, but was always prepared to vehemently argue the case if I did.

Don't use club sites mostly CL and CS sites and even at the ones that have a second vehicle charge haven't been charged extra. Presume they treat it same as a caravan and car only one lot of wear and tear during the stay and don't take up any more space.
